>>> Not exactly, my understanding is that *accountsservice* doesn't find
>>> 'org.freedesktop.Accounts.service' which is provided (and asked) by
>>> lightdm. (I think the error comes from accountsservice)
>>
>> But see:
>>
>> $ (cd /tmp; tar xf $(guix build -S lightdm))
>> $ grep -r "Error updating user" /tmp/lightdm-1.30.0/
>> /tmp/lightdm-1.30.0/common/user-list.c: g_warning ("Error updating
>> user %s: %s", priv->path, error->message);
>> /tmp/lightdm-1.30.0/common/user-list.c: g_warning ("Error updating
>> user %s: %s", priv->path, error->message);
>> $ (cd /tmp; tar xf $(guix build -S accountsservice))
>> $ find /tmp/accountsservice-0.6.50/ -name org.freedesktop\*.service.in
>> /tmp/accountsservice-0.6.50/data/org.freedesktop.Accounts.service.in
>> $ find $(guix build accountsservice) -name org.freedesktop\*.service
>> /gnu/store/l9qyf0brhhq7mwcsyhjsh7k0d3ri3ay2-accountsservice-0.6.50/share/dbus-1/system-services/org.freedesktop.Accounts.service
>>
>> That’s why I think it’s lightdm (or dbus-daemon?) that fails to find the
>> .service file.
>>
>> ‘accountsservice-service-type’ extends dbus, such that we have
>> /etc/dbus-1/system-services/org.freedesktop.Accounts.service. Do you
>> see this as well?
>
> You're right! ;) And probably a dbus-daemon problem from what I
> understand. But I really don't know what I'm talking about here...
> However, just to clarify, I think it's not that it's not finding
> dbus-1/system-services/org.freedesktop.Accounts.service but
> dbus-1/interfaces/org.freedesktop.Accounts(.Users?).xml. In that case,
> using #:env-variable for the dbus service might be a possibility.
> Really, I have quite a lot of files in
> /run/current-system/profile/share/dbus-1/interfaces but I don't know what are
> their purpose... :/
I think we’d need to look at the lightdm service to further debug this.
It’s not upstream yet, right?
